Position Summary

The University at Buffalo (UB) School of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ences (SPPS) Department of Pharmacy Practice, Division of Outcomes and Practice Advancement is seeking a clinical-track (qualified rank), 12-month faculty member at the assistant or associate professor rank, with expertise in inpatient acute care pharmacy.

Responsibilities:

  • Teaching:
    The faculty member will be expected to coordinate and teach content in their area of expertise. The faculty member will be expected to maintain a clinical practice site focused on transitions of care, where they will train IPPE students, APPE students, and postgraduate residents/fellows. It is estimated that experiential and didactic teaching will represent 85% effort during year 1 (70% experiential + 15% didactic), 80% effort during years 2-3 (60% experiential + 20% didactic), and 70% effort thereon (40% experiential + 30% didactic).
  • Research/Scholarship:
    The faculty member will advance the research mission of the UB SPPS. They will engage in collaborative research while developing an independent research program in their area of expertise and will publish/present their work nationally/internationally. It is estimated that research/scholarship will represent 10% effort during year 1, 15% effort during years 2-3, and 20% effort thereon.
  • Service:
    The faculty member will serve the Department, School, and University as agreed to with the Chair of the Department of Pharmacy Practice and Division Head for Outcomes and Practice Advancement. This will include, but is not limited to, active participation on committees, PharmD student admissions reviews/interviews, student advising, and mentoring of postgraduate residents and fellows. It is estimated that research/scholarship will represent 5% effort during years 1-3, and 10% effort during year 3.

Description of institution/organization:

The University at Buffalo (UB) is a research-1 institution with recognition as a member of the Association of American Universities and is the top-ranked public university in New York State. The UB School of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ences (SPPS), which was founded in 1886, is ranked #19 nationally and #1 in New York State. The mission of the SPPS is to improve healthcare quality and outcomes through educating the next generation of pharmacists and pharmaceutical scientists in an environment fostering intellectual curiosity, through pursuing impactful basic and applied research, and through developing and evaluating models of clinical practice.

The SPPS encourages work-life balance and is committed to fostering and maintaining a diverse work culture that respects the rights and dignity of everyone. The SPPS offers a formal mentoring program and faculty development program to help new faculty successfully transition into the Academy: The goal of this highly successful program is to facilitate growth of individual faculty members in the areas of education, research/scholarship, and service, and to help them achieve their personal/professional goals while meeting the overall department mission.

Minimum Qualifications
A Doctor of Pharmacy degree; a minimum of two years of postdoctoral training.

Preferred Qualifications
BCPS or other relevant BPS certification.

Candidates must have a track record of research support and peer reviewed publications commensurate with appointment faculty rank.
